Impero leads WWU men’s basketball to home win

Senior guard Kyle Impero scored a game-high 23 points to lead the Western Washington Vikings to a 101-64 victory over Simon Fraser University on Tuesday, Dec. 15, in a Great Northwest Athletic Conference men’s basketball game at Whatcom Pavilion.

The Vikings improved to 7-4 overall and are off to a 2-1 start in GNAC play. Simon Fraser drops to 1-8 overall and 0-3 in conference games. Western has won 14 of the last 15 meetings vs. the Clan.

Impero led the Vikings in scoring for the fourth time this season. After missing his first shot of the game, he was a perfect 9 for 9 from the field the rest of the way to finish with his third 20-plus point game of the season. In 11 games this season he is averaging 16.5 points per game.

Impero led three Vikings in double-digits scoring, with junior forward Jeffrey Parker scoring 22 points and sophomore guard Brett Kingma adding 19 points (five 3-pointers).

Sophomore forward Evan Scholten made his season debut after coming back from a broken bone in his right (shooting) hand to contribute three points, three rebounds and a pair of blocked shots. Senior point guard Ricardo Maxwell tallied a season high 10 assists.

Overall the Vikings shot 52.9 percent from the field, hitting a season-high 14 three-pointers. WWU had a 25-to-10 assist to turnover ratio and went 13 for 15 from the free throw line.

“I thought we brought a lot of energy to the court tonight and shared the ball well,” WWU coach Tony Dominguez said in a news release. “We stressed all week in practice to make that extra pass and extend our offense. I thought we did that tonight. I am proud of our assist-to-turnover ratio.”

Simon Fraser was led by 17 points from JJ. Pankratz and 12 points from Hidde Vos. The Clan played without two of their top players, Max Barkley (17.3 ppg) and Oshea Gairey (11.0 ppg).
